Rose’s Coming To Dillon
Rose’s is coming to Dillon. Henderson, North Carolina based Variety Wholesalers, Inc. a discount retailer announced it will open a Rose’s store at 413 Radford Blvd., in the former BI-LO Food Store location.

Commerce Launches Aerospace Task Force
The South Carolina Department of Commerce today announced that Charlie Farrell will direct the new S.C. Aerospace Task Force, an advisory council to the Secretary of Commerce on the development of a strategic initiative to enhance and grow the state’s aerospace industry.

Two Local Veterans Go On WWII Honor Flight
Recognizing the valor of South Carolinians who fought in World War II, 19 electric cooperatives Wednesday joined Honor Flight of South Carolina to fly 100 veterans including two Dillon County men to Washington, D.C., to visit the memorial built in their honor and other historic sites.

Elvington Appointed Dillon Postmaster
Tammy Elvington, Postmaster Hamer, SC EAS -16, has been appointed to the position of Postmaster, Dillon, SC EAS - 20. The effective date for this appointment is April 7, 2012.
